Improve C# code performance with Span<T>

This page summarizes the projects mentioned and recommended in the original post on /r/dotnet

CodeRabbit: AI Code Reviews for Developers
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
coderabbit.ai
featured
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
  • Introducing .NET Multi-platform App UI (MAUI)

    .NET MAUI is the .NET Multi-platform App UI, a framework for building native device applications spanning mobile, tablet, and desktop.

    For example, we recently promoted this feature from the .NET MAUI Community Toolkit into .NET MAUI: https://github.com/dotnet/maui/issues/2703

  • CodeRabbit

    C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.

    CodeRabbit logo
  • UWP Community Toolkit

    The Windows Community Toolkit is a collection of helpers, extensions, and custom controls. It simplifies and demonstrates common developer tasks building .NET apps with UWP and the Windows App SDK / WinUI 3 for Windows 10 and Windows 11. The toolkit is part of the .NET Foundation.

    That's interesting. It will need some documentation and to finish the renaming at some point, e.g. Span2D is in https://github.com/CommunityToolkit/WindowsCommunityToolkit but as you say doesn't require Windows.

  • CommunityToolkit

    The Official Docs for the Community Toolkits

    The docs are open source as well and you can track our progress here! https://github.com/MicrosoftDocs/CommunityToolkit

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ts

  • Does anyone here have a long background with Java before switching/using C#? What caused you to switch and what do you miss about Java that C# doesn't have?

    2 projects | /r/csharp | 17 Apr 2022
  • Ask HN: Best stack for cross-platform desktop app?

    10 projects | news.ycombinator.com | 14 Apr 2021
  • Dezvoltare aplicatie desktop

    3 projects | /r/programare | 7 Dec 2023
  • Cross-platform desktop applications

    2 projects | /r/dotnet | 27 Jun 2023
  • Avalonia UI and MAUI - Something for everyone

    3 projects | dev.to | 29 Mar 2023

Did you konow that C# is
the 9th most popular programming language
based on number of metions?